Educational attainment, at least completed short-cycle tertiary in Peru
Peru: Educational attainment, at least completed short-cycle tertiary was 14.5% in 2024. ▲ Rising
Educational attainment, at least completed short-cycle tertiary in Peru, 1972–2024
Source: Data API, UN Educational, Scientific and Cultural Organization (UNESCO). Measured in cumulative.
Analysis
The most recent figure for educational attainment, at least completed short-cycle tertiary in Peru is 14.5%, measured in 2024.
The figure is up 1.7% on the previous year and down 30.8% over ten years.
Over the whole period, educational attainment, at least completed short-cycle tertiary in Peru peaked at 24.0% in 2021 and was at its lowest, 3.0%, in 1972.
Peru ranks 95th of 128 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 26 years of available data.
